First post here, new to Forum.
I had a good experience with buying a Jasper remanufactured engine a few years ago. I bought a Jasper 6.9L diesel engine for my F-250 after original motor blew at 300K. I had it installed by a Ford truck dealer, and the engine AND labor was warrantied by Jasper for 1 year. Looking at the Jasper site now, Complete gasoline engines now have 3 year/100K PARTS + LABOR WARRANTY.

I'm glad I went with Jasper because that engine developed a crack in the block near a freeze plug within that year. Heintzelman Ford and I filed a claim with Jasper and sure enough, Jasper paid for the removal, re-install, and replacement engine all at their cost. The replacement engine lasted another 100K with me until I sold the truck years later.

When considering replacing an engine, you need to determine if saving money on the front end will really be worth it or spending a little more for the peace of mind.

Especially with Expeditions and their resale value, would it be better to replace the entire vehicle with a good used Expedition or are you planning on keeping your baby regardless of whatever it's worth? A $2-3000 investment for engine will not increase the resale value at all.

I just had my 98 in the shop a month ago for 5.4 install final bill was $5700 that was engine and all necessary components ,fluids and labor

This is true, but look at our members that bought worn out 250k plus models that a had a bazillion problems. Maybe our forum members get lucky like I did and buy a 15 year old expedition with 64k on it. Always look for a low mileage car or truck. I've tried the other way, high mileage, real cheap. But no matter what you change, you still have a worn out, squeaky, rattly SUV. It takes a lot of searching, but the low mile ones are out there. You might pay a little more up front, but it's worth it in the long run. Always better to put on your own miles, than wonder how the past owner drove, or maintained your vehicle. It's always worked for me. I've owned over 40 cars and motorcycles in my past, the low mileage ones, have always been the nicest.
